Jace never expected to love Clary, he never knew what they were or what they thought they were. He wanted to trust her, needed to trust her, and he did all up to a certain part. He told no one, he owed a debt to a certain fanged fiend. She excepted nothing but the payment that made her feel like she ripped everything away from you, everything you hold dear, everything that ever meant anything she took from you by taking you from them. Jace asked her to help him save his mother when he was young. She never forgot. She watched him grow. When she thought he was old enough, she hunted him down, he never paid her. In truth he never forgot her either, he knew the price of a vampire's help but he had no other choice, it was either risk or stand aside and cry helplessly as his mother faded before him. He risked It, now she wanted payment. The young shadowhunter thought he could run, escape her but oh how wrong he was. She will get her payment anyway she can, In his case, a capture....imprisonment......
